A Poem by Li Yan
"

A poem about the expectations people have of you, and the feeling where you're compelled to reach those expectations to the extent that you lose your sense of identity.

"

A girl skips proudly and jolly

Her heart leaping a thousand miles

Where shall she go, Oh where shall she go

"Somewhere no one knows"

She says, though her voice shakes with fear


But no darling, You've no right to be afraid

It's your duty to smile, like icing on a cake

So we'll stitch your lips up with a very thin needle

But fear not, fear not! It won't hurt at all

You use it everyday, on your clothes and rags


Wear a dainty elegant dress and be

The princess of your time

We're all depending on you to do everything right


Don't trip, don't fall, use the right spoon

Always keep your mask on or else you shall lose


And when you're finally alone

You may look in a mirror

and gasp at the sight of a faceless figure


There's nothing but a stitched up smile that never falters

And a knife in your hand to be pierced into your chest


For what is the purpose of all the jewels and glamour

You have ceased to exist centuries ago

And yet you still remain the same, and all alone


There's no escape for your doom has yet to come

Even if you run

We'll find you, We'll find you


Your friends whom you trusted with your soul

They too have abandoned you

Your home has been burnt to ashes

Your memories no longer your own


Even if you dream of running

In your dreams

We'll find you, We'll find you
